View looking south southeast at 9:00 PM (SkyChart III). Uranus (Mag 5.7 in Aquarius), followed by a full moon (97% illuminated), rises two hours before sunset and will be visible with binoculars in the south southeast after the end of evening twilight. Neptune (Mag 7.9 in Capricornus) rises several hours before sunset. Binoculars or a small telescope will be needed to find this planet in the south during the evening. |
